The campaign committee of Minnesota Democratic-Farmer-La candidate Antone Melton-Meaux, Antone for Congress, received $1,000 from Joy Hereford on July 1, according to the Federal Election Commission (FEC).

Antone for Congress has received $3.2 million in contributions since the beginning of the year.
